GENERAL MARSHALL MAY RETIRE

WASHINGTON, June 9

The "Army and Navy Journal" in a front-page editorial, says that General G. C. Marshall intends to retire, possibly opening the way for General Eisenhower to direct the final assault on Japan as Chief of Staff. The journal urges President Truman to persuade General Marshall not to retire.
